At its core, cardiovascular fitness refers to the ability of the heart and lungs to supply oxygen to the muscles during physical activity. Synonyms for cardiovascular fitness include cardiovascular endurance, aerobic fitness, and cardiorespiratory fitness. Cardiovascular Endurance

Cardiovascular endurance is one of the most common synonyms for cardiovascular fitness. It refers to the body's ability to perform physical activities that require sustained effort over an extended period. This can include activities such as running, cycling, or swimming.

Aerobic Fitness

Aerobic fitness is another synonym for cardiovascular fitness that is commonly used in medical terminology. It refers to the body's ability to use oxygen to generate energy during physical activity. Aerobic fitness is often measured by the maximum amount of oxygen that the body can consume during exercise.

Cardiorespiratory Fitness

Cardiorespiratory fitness is a term that is often used interchangeably with cardiovascular fitness. It refers to the ability of the heart, lungs, and blood vessels to supply oxygen to the muscles during physical activity. This is an essential component of overall health and wellness, and improving cardiorespiratory fitness can have a significant impact on quality of life.

How to Improve Cardiovascular Fitness

If you're looking to improve your cardiovascular fitness, there are several things you can do. First, try to incorporate regular aerobic exercise into your daily routine. This can include activities such as walking, running, cycling, or swimming.

Additionally, consider incorporating strength training into your exercise routine. Building muscle can help to improve your overall fitness level and increase your cardiorespiratory fitness.

Q: Is cardiovascular fitness the same thing as heart health?

A: While cardiovascular fitness and heart health are related, they are not the same thing. Cardiovascular fitness refers to the body's ability to provide oxygen to the muscles during physical activity, while heart health refers specifically to the health of the heart.
